What is CCOR?
CCOR was created on 2017-05-24 by Core Alternative. The fund's investment portfolio concentrates primarily on total market equity. The ETF currently has 31.06m in AUM and 40 holdings. CCOR is an actively managed ETF that seeks capital appreciation and preservation with low correlation to the broad US equity market. The fund primarily holds dividend-paying large-cap stocks with an option collar overlay.
